在现代网页设计中,交互性和用户体验至关重要。许多开发者希望通过简洁且直观的界面来提升用户的操作便利性。jQuery iButton是一种流行的解决方案,可以帮助开发者轻松实现各种动态开关控件。本文将全面解析jQuery iButton,探讨其功能、使用方法以及最佳实践,以提高网页的用户交互性。
什么是jQuery iButton?
jQuery iButton是一个可自定义的开关控件插件,通常用于将传统的复选框和单选框转换为更美观的开关按钮。用户可以通过点击按钮轻松切换状态,提升视觉效果和用户体验。这个插件以其简洁的设计和强大的功能,赢得了很多开发者的青睐。
jQuery iButton的主要特点
jQuery iButton具有许多显著特点,使其成为一种理想的控件选择:
- 简约设计:iButton外观简洁,用户易于理解,提升了界面的友好性。
- 良好的可定制性:开发者可以根据自己的需求调整样式和功能,包括按钮颜色、尺寸等。
- 易于使用:jQuery iButton的集成和使用过程很简单,插件文档详尽友好。
- 响应式设计:iButton在不同屏幕尺寸上的表现出色,适应移动端和桌面端的用户体验。
安装和使用jQuery iButton
要使用jQuery iButton,首先需要在项目中引入必要的文件,包括jQuery库和iButton插件文件。下面是具体步骤:
步骤1:引入文件
确保在HTML页面中加入以下代码:
<link rel="stylesheet" >
<script src="path/to/jquery.min.js"></script>
<script src="path/to/jquery.ibutton.js"></script>
步骤2:创建HTML结构
在HTML中创建一个复选框,将其转换为iButton:
<input type="checkbox" id="mySwitch">
步骤3:初始化iButton
使用以下jQuery代码来初始化iButton:
$(document).ready(function() {
$('#mySwitch').iButton();
});
jQuery iButton的配置选项
jQuery iButton提供了一些可配置的选项,以满足不同需求:
- labelOn:设置打开状态的标签。
- labelOff:设置关闭状态的标签。
- labelWidth:定义标签宽度。
- duration:设置开关切换的动画持续时间。
例如,下面的代码修改了标签和动画:
$('#mySwitch').iButton({
labelOn: '打开',
labelOff: '关闭',
duration: 500
});
在项目中利用jQuery iButton的最佳实践
为了有效利用jQuery iButton,以下是一些最佳实践:
- 确保与其他CSS和JavaScript文件的兼容性,避免冲突。
- 在移动设备上测试控件,确保良好的触控体验。
- 适当使用标签,更好地传达控件的状态。
- 始终关注无障碍(Accessibility),确保所有用户都能操作开关。
常见问题解答
jQuery iButton能够支持哪些浏览器?
大多数现代浏览器都支持jQuery iButton,包括Chrome、Firefox、Safari和Edge等。
是否可以在项目中自定义图标?
是的,jQuery iButton允许用户替换默认图标,开发者可以根据需要添加自定义图标。
如何提高jQuery iButton的性能?
优化HTML结构和CSS样式,尽量减小插件文件的大小,能够有效提高性能。
总结
通过使用jQuery iButton,开发者可以创建出功能强大且视觉吸引的动态开关控件,不仅提升了用户体验,也使得代码的可维护性得到了增强。希望通过本文,您对jQuery iButton有了更深入的理解,并能够在您的项目中灵活运用。感谢您阅读完这篇文章,期望这会对您的开发工作有所帮助!
- 相关评论
- 我要评论
-